Patent number: 11642033Abstract: A vital-sign radar sensor uses wireless internet signals to detect vital signs. It includes a first and second demodulation unit to demodulate an incident and reflected wireless internet signal with an injection-locked oscillator into a first and second demodulated signal, respectively. The combined use of the first and second demodulated signals can eliminate the influence of communication modulation on the extraction process of a Doppler shift due to vital signs. Moreover, the vital-sign radar sensor is a receive-only device so that it won't cause interference to ambient wireless communication networks.Type: GrantFiled: January 29, 2021Date of Patent: May 9, 2023Assignee: NATIONAL SUN YAT-SEN UNIVERSITYInventors: Tzyy-Sheng Horng, Yi-Chen Lai, Jui-Yen Lin

Patent number: 10539439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for device-free motion detection and presence detection within an area of interest. A plurality of nodes, configured to be arranged around the area of interest, form a wireless network. The plurality of nodes transmit wireless signals as radio waves and receive transmitted wireless signals. The received signal strength (RSS) of the transmitted wireless signals between the plurality of nodes are measured and a value is reported. A computing device receives the reported values for the measured RSS and tracks the reported values over time. The computing device processes the reported values using an aggregate disturbance calculation to detect motion and presence within the area of interest. The computing device may notify notification device of a detected disturbance within the area of interest.Type: GrantFiled: October 22, 2018Date of Patent: January 21, 2020Assignee: Xandem Technology, LLCInventor: Anthony Joseph Wilson

Patent number: 10497230Abstract: A barrier alarm device for reducing the number of false alarms that may occur in a home security system. In one embodiment, a barrier alarm device, such as a door or window sensor, determines whether a barrier, such as a door or a window, has been opened, determines whether a human being is in proximity to the door or window inside a monitored premises. If a human being is inside the monitored premises when the door or window is opened, it indicates that the human being is authorized to be inside the monitored premises, and an alarm signal is not transmitted to a central security panel, thus reducing false alarms.Type: GrantFiled: April 5, 2018Date of Patent: December 3, 2019Assignee: Ecolink Intelligent Technology, Inc.Inventors: Michael Lamb, Michael Bailey, Thomas Thibault, George Seelman, Carlo Q. Patent number: 9030310Abstract: A proximity-based catalytic converter protection system for a vehicle that includes a controller, and a catalytic converter, both located in the vehicle. The protection system further includes a pair of electrodes that are electrically coupled to the controller and located in proximity to the converter. The controller monitors capacitance between the electrodes to detect movement external to the vehicle near the converter. The controller may activate an alarm element upon detecting a change in capacitance between the electrodes that exceeds a predetermined threshold.Type: GrantFiled: December 24, 2012Date of Patent: May 12, 2015Assignee: Ford Global Technologies, LLCInventors: John R.
